Appropriations were passed for the governance of the District of Columbia when the House agreed to H.R. 3026. Of note was the absence of abortion funding restrictions. The legislation favors pro-choice advocates and was the first since the Supreme Court ruled to give individual state more freedom to restrict abortions. The House agreed to the conference report on H.R. 1278, to reform, recapitalize, and consolidate the Federal deposit insurance system, and to enhance the regulatory and enforcement powers of federal financial institution regulatory agencies. This clears the measure for Senate action. Also, the House passed H.R. 3015, making appropriations for the Department of Transportation and related agencies for fiscal year 1990. close
